Dan Bourne

Keyboards / Lead and Backing Vocals / Percussion / "Dr. J"

Dan "Boudy" started tickling the ivories at the early age of 5. While playing percussion in the high school band, he started a rock group, and later helped put together Blue Soul, a popular central Kentucky group in the late 60s. He then played with the band Cold Smoke in the Greater Cincinnati area for almost 25 years. Thanks to his wife showing him a "Wanted-Keyboard Man" ad, Dan ended a brief retirement to join Caught Red Handed.

Dan is proud of the groups tight, multi-part harmonies, and he has the classic "do it right, or don't do it" attitude. He also plays a primary role in the variety and arrangements of Caught Red Handed material. He conjures a classic sound with his KORG CX3 and Leslie Tone Cabinet (which replaced the "love-to-hear-it, hate-to-lift-it" Hammond A100), and, along with an Ensoniq TS10 synthesizer and a Yamaha PSR keyboard can reproduce most any sound or tone that is required in the wide range of songs on the Band's play list. Dan takes his position as the "Patriarch" (aka "Pops" ) of the band seriously, but never forgets to have a good time!
